Morrison Water Services is currently looking to recruit a Safety, Health, Environmental and Wellbeing (SHEW) Advisor for our Southern Water Frameworks based in Falmer.
As a Safety, Health, Environmental and Wellbeing (SHEW) Advisor, you will report to and support the SHEW Manager, ensuring the delivery of legislative compliance and promote continuous improvement of Safety, Health, Environmental and Wellbeing performance.
You will be a highly organised, efficient multitasking and flexible individual who is keen to be part of a vibrant team.
As a SHEQ Advisor:
- You will work collaboratively with other functions from early works and design through construction to commissioning ensuring projects meet health and safety requirements.
- You will support the design team to discharge their roles as principal designer and / or designer under CDM Regulations and assist in the early identification and mitigation of risk strategies.
- You will advise construction managers, team leaders and site operatives in the field of statutory health and safety requirements, whilst providing support in identifying solutions and options for continual improvement.
- You will review risk assessments and method statements, including those of sub-contractors and where necessary support the operational team in the identification, and implementation of suitable control measures.
- You will regularly inspect work locations monitoring direct employees and sub-contractors via site inspection and management audits, and submit these in a timely manner, ensuring safety critical activity controls (including temporary works) are identified and implemented safely.
- You will provide training, advice and guidance, encouraging continual improvement through proactive engagement with Operatives and Supervisors.
- You will conduct competency checks and undertake D&A testing (random & following incidents) and assist in the development and delivery of inductions, toolbox talks and & safety briefings.
- You will conduct investigations of incidents and accidents, identifying root cause analysis and recommendations to prevent re-occurrence.
- Report and investigate incidents in line with Client and MWS minimum requirements and submit reports within agreed timescales. You’ll also ensure actions from investigations are acted upon and close-out the report in a timely manner.
- You will assist in the identification of training needs for site based personnel and support wellbeing initiatives.
- You will have the opportunity to suggest, communicate and promote improvement initiatives, promoting innovation and different ways of working, together with monitoring compliance with both the Morrison Water Services management system and our clients requirements.
